Output 51d3b1cb9e1a1f739f4dc8fe0aed804723229d1c476851ef5a68f290badc43e9:3

value
3130699
script pubkey
OP_0 OP_PUSHBYTES_20 9ad08f90ef6f4be377930e48c5baa4d6498b8d6f
address
bc1qntggly80da97xaunpeyvtw4y6eychrt0uz6q3z
transaction
51d3b1cb9e1a1f739f4dc8fe0aed804723229d1c476851ef5a68f290badc43e9